change handling of sub-tools, allow configuring ToolHandleArray properties
Originally the goal was just to allow handling `ToolHandleArray` properties, but it turned out to be a lot easier if subtools are represented by `AsgToolConfig` in turn.
Showing
- Control/AthToolSupport/AsgExampleTools/AsgExampleTools/IUnitTestTool2.h 6 additions, 0 deletions...lSupport/AsgExampleTools/AsgExampleTools/IUnitTestTool2.h
- Control/AthToolSupport/AsgExampleTools/AsgExampleTools/UnitTestTool2.h 7 additions, 0 deletions...olSupport/AsgExampleTools/AsgExampleTools/UnitTestTool2.h
- Control/AthToolSupport/AsgExampleTools/Root/UnitTestTool2.cxx 12 additions, 0 deletions...rol/AthToolSupport/AsgExampleTools/Root/UnitTestTool2.cxx
- Control/AthToolSupport/AsgExampleTools/test/gt_AsgToolConfig.cxx 41 additions, 0 deletions.../AthToolSupport/AsgExampleTools/test/gt_AsgToolConfig.cxx
- Control/AthToolSupport/AsgTools/AsgTools/AsgComponentConfig.h 69 additions, 7 deletions...rol/AthToolSupport/AsgTools/AsgTools/AsgComponentConfig.h
- Control/AthToolSupport/AsgTools/AsgTools/ToolHandleArray.h 2 additions, 0 deletionsControl/AthToolSupport/AsgTools/AsgTools/ToolHandleArray.h
- Control/AthToolSupport/AsgTools/AsgTools/ToolHandleArray.icc 6 additions, 0 deletionsControl/AthToolSupport/AsgTools/AsgTools/ToolHandleArray.icc
- Control/AthToolSupport/AsgTools/Root/AnaToolHandle.cxx 1 addition, 1 deletionControl/AthToolSupport/AsgTools/Root/AnaToolHandle.cxx
- Control/AthToolSupport/AsgTools/Root/AsgComponentConfig.cxx 138 additions, 156 deletionsControl/AthToolSupport/AsgTools/Root/AsgComponentConfig.cxx
Loading
Please register or sign in to comment